zblog获取当前文章所有标签关键词的代码函数TagsName

zblog教程 315

很多主题会默认读取文章所有的标签作为内容页关键词,而读取标签的方式通常会使用遍历,这是因为很多主题作者不会去翻看zblog php程序源代码,所以不知道其实zblog本身有提供获取文章所有标签的函数TagsToNameString(),而且可以直接使用模板标签调用,并不需要再在模板里遍历拼接的。

文章页获取所有文章标签的模板标签:

1
$article->TagsName

获取直接使用函数

1
$article->TagsToNameString()

代码位置:zb_system/function/lib/base/post.php

补充:遍历方式获取文章标签的代码

1
2
3
4
5
$aryTags = array();
foreach($article->Tags as $key){
	$aryTags[] = $key->Name;
}
$tags = count($aryTags)>0 ? implode(',',$aryTags) : '';

精品推荐: